/* CSS Document */

/*
<div class="form t5 l5 w5 h5"></div>
<div class="formBox t5 l5 w5 h5"></div>
<div class="popup t5 l5 w5 h5"></div>
<div class="popupbox t5 l5 w5 h5"></div>
<div class="dashBox t5 l5 w5 h5"></div>
<div class="_mc t5 l5 w5 h5"></div>
*/

/*-------------------popup window-------------------*/
/*-------------------popup window-------------------*/

/*
<div class="popup t45 l45 w500 h500" id="X-popup_mc">
<div class="putittxt t5 l10">Test Popup</div>
<div class="close-popup_btn t0 l475 nsel" id="X-close_btn">&#10005;</div>
<div class="minimize_popup_btn t0 l450 nsel" id="X-minus_btn">&minus;</div>
<div class="drag-popup_btn t0 l375 nsel" id="X-drag_btn">&#9776;</div>
<div class="popupbox t30 l5 w490 h465">Box - optional</div>
</div>	

<script> // Popup Drag ------------------------------------->
dragElement("X-drag_btn","X-popup_mc");
$("#X-drag_btn").on('mousedown', function(){$(this).css('cursor','grabbing');
$(document).on('mouseup',function(){$("#X-drag_btn").css('cursor','grab');});});
</script><!-- END Popup Drag ------------------------------->
*/

.fll{float: left;}
.flr{float: right;}

/*-------------------popup window-------------------*/
.popup, .popupf{
position:absolute;
display: block;
background-color: rgba(255,255,255,0.98);
border-radius: 2px;
border: 1px solid rgba(0,0,0,1.00);
box-shadow: 5px 5px 10px 10px rgba(0,0,0,0.75);
}

.popupbox, .popupboxf{
background-color: rgba(236,236,236,0.98);
}

.popupbox{position: relative;} 
.popupboxf{display: block; position:absolute;}


.putittxt{
display: inline-block;
float: left;
color: rgba(108,108,108,1.00);
border: none;
font-size: 16px;
font-family: 'Helvetica', 'Tahoma', 'Geneva', sans-serif;
font-weight: bold;
overflow: hidden;
margin-top: 5px;
margin-left: 10px;
-webkit-touch-callout: none; /* iOS Safari */
-webkit-user-select: none; /* Safari */
-khtml-user-select: none; /* Konqueror HTML */
-moz-user-select: none; /* Old versions of Firefox */
-ms-user-select: none; /* Internet Explorer/Edge */
user-select: none; /* Chrome, Edge, Opera and Firefox */
}


.close-popup_btn, .minimize_popup_btn, .drag-popup_btn{
display: flex;
justify-content: center; /* Horizontal */
align-items: center;     /* Vertical */
background-color:rgba(173,173,173,1.00);
float: right;
color: white;
border: none;
font-size: 14px;
font-family: 'Helvetica', 'Tahoma', 'Geneva', sans-serif;
font-weight: bold;
width: 22px;
height: 22px;
line-height: 22px;
}

.close-popup_btn{border-top-right-radius: 2px;}
.minimize_popup_btn, .drag-popup_btn{margin-right: 1px;}

.close-popup_btn:hover, .minimize_popup_btn:hover{
cursor: pointer;
background-color:rgba(106,106,106,1.00);
}

.drag-popup_btn:hover{
cursor: grab;
background-color:rgba(106,106,106,1.00);
}

/*-------------------form box-------------------*/
/*-------------------form box-------------------*/
.form-cont {
content: "";
clear: both;
width: 100%;
margin: 0;
padding: 0;
}

.form{
background-color:rgba(219,219,219,1.00);
border-radius: 5px;
}

.formBox{
position:absolute;
display: block;
background-color: rgba(204,204,204,1.00);
}

.formBoxM{
display: block;
background-color: rgba(204,204,204,1.00);
}


/*-------------------dash box-------------------*/
/*-------------------dash box-------------------*/
.dashBox{
position:absolute;
display: block;
background-color: rgba(120,120,120,1.00);
}

.dashBoxM{
display: block;
background-color: rgba(120,120,120,1.00);
}

.dashBoxMclear{
display: block;
}


/*----------index container-----------------------------*/
.index-Cont{
position: absolute;
display:none;
top: 0px;
left: 0px;
/*width: 1px;
height: 1px;*/
padding: 0px;
margin: 0px;
overflow: auto;
}




/*----------mc container-----------------------------*/
._mc{
position: relative;
padding: 0px;
margin: 0px;
}






